By the time you get around to reading this, I will be on my way to Taos.  You guys know I get up there once or twice a year.  I especially love going this time of year because our place is at 8500 feet…which means, cold nights, cool days.  I cannot WAIT to get out of this heat.  And I really like going to the mountains because there is always so much to do.  Hiking, trail running, horseback riding, hot air ballooning, 4-wheelers, fishing, shopping, eating.

But today, I got one of those social media alerts about a deal on a beach house in Cabo San Lucas.  That’s kind of hot, too.  But there is the ocean right in front of you to cool off.  And there is beer and mojitos and cold drinks in pineapple shells.  There is zip-lining and snorkling and jet skis.  I think I could be very comfortable on the beach.

A few weeks ago, we were in New York.  I would like to go to New York on vacation, and not for work.  Because even though it is hot, it’s not as hot as it is here.  And there is shopping and walking and shows to see and great food for gnoshing and cosmopolitan living.
